Resumo: This study aimed to analyze changes in the eating and in the physical activity behaviors in individuals with diabetes mellitus type 2, through strategies of intervention based on transtheoretical model (MTT) during six months. Thirty one individuals, of both sexes, aged between 41 and 75 years, were evaluated -demographic characteristics were collected through semi-structured interviews. The stages of MTT behavior changes in the eating and physical activity behaviors were identified using one algorithm for the eating behavior and another for the physical activity behavior. Body weight, height and waist and hip circumferences were measured and the body mass index (BMI) and the waist to hip ratio (W/H) were calculated. The fat percentage (% FAT) was collected through electrical bipolar bioimpedance. The blood parameters: complete blood count, fasting glucose, glycated hemoglobin, total cholesterol, HDL, LDL, VLDL and triglycerides were analyzed. All the evaluations were made before and after a six-month period of interventions, composed of guided physical activity and nutritional counseling. The results showed that before the intervention, most of the diabetics were in the MTT preparation stage, for the eating behavior and in the maintenance stage for the physical activity behavior. After six months of interventions, a move to the action stage for the eating behavior was observed and for the physical activity behavior the maintenance stage was preserved. Body weight, BMI, fasting glucose, glycated hemoglobin, total cholesterol and LDL reduced significantly (p<0,05) after the period of interventions. W/H and % FAT did not change. There was a positive correlation between the family income and schooling (p<0,05), number of people in the house (p<0,05) and the consumption intake behavior (p<0,05) of the individuals. Schooling also correlated positively with eating behavior (p<0,01) as well as the eating behavior with the physical activity behavior (p<0,01). It was concluded that individuals with diabetes mellitus type 2 respond to interventions for changes in eating and physical activity behaviors. These changes positively impacted the anthropometrical and biochemical parameters. The education level and family income are associated to the level of readiness for these changes.
